First, all pages when connecting to the website with an SSL request work.

Problem:  Internet Explorer, while receiving pages and otherwise effectively
communicating with the web server, does not show that the connection is a
secure connection.  This occurs ONLY with Tomcat serviced responses.  Files
handled by Apache directly DO show the "secure" connection icon in Internet
Explorer.  Netscape shows the connection as secure always.

Anybody know what's causing this, and (more importantly) how to correct it?

Is there something in the server.xml that I can set to correct this?  Since
I am allowing Apache to handle the SSL duties, I didn't figure Tomcat should
have to do anything. Is it mod_jk that's screwing things up, or is it
Tomcat?
